Pronunciation tip: Saw-lutay. You can also say “a la vita” which means “to life” if you want to say “cheers” in Italian. There is also “cin cin” (pronounced as “chin chin”) which is meant to imitate the sound of glasses clinking together. 16.

Hip hip hooray (also hippity hip hooray; Hooray may also be spelled and pronounced hoorah, hurrah, hurray etc.) is a cheer called out to express congratulation toward someone or something, in the English-speaking world and elsewhere. Good morning - kalimera (if you know the person a little) or kalimera sas (if you don't know them or want to show respect for an older person. Good night = kali nikta or kali nikta sas (same reasons as above) Good evening = Kalispera or Kalispera sas (same reasons as above) christiane germain wikipediaWebDec 15, 2024 · If you find yourself toasting in a local bar with Greek people, you’ll eventually hear the word Γειά μας! (Yiamas!) , meaning Cheers, which is the commonly shortened version of the sentence above. This version is the most used all across Greece.
